    3. Hi, I am hoping someone might help me out with this puzzle. In the 1860 census for Cherokee Co. NC, there is a family Parker, Alexander 33 farmer born in Macon Co NC Parker, Mary 31 " Buncombe Co NC Parker, John 9 " Macon Co NC Parker, Josephine 7 " Cherokee Co NC Parker, Harriet 5 " Cherokee Co NC Parker, Ellen 3 " Cherokee Co NC This family is in the Shoal Creek Dist. In the 1870 census of Cherokee Co NC In the Notla or Nottla Twp Parker, Alexander 40 Parker, Louarra 29 Parker, Reuben 3 Rice, William 8 Rice, Jessee 6 In the Shoal Creek Twp Ingram, John 69 Ingram, Mary 60 Ingram, Harriett 35 Ingram, Arminda 25 Ingram, Dulcena 22 Parker, John 19 Parker, Jossee 17 Parker, Harriet 15 Parker, Elen 13 Parker, Mary 11 Is this the same Alexander Parker in 1870 and where is the wife Mary Ingram? These are the children of Alexander & Mary living with their grandparents in 1870. In the 1880 census of Cherokee Co NC in the Nottla or Notla Twp Parker, Alexander 50 Parker, Mary L. 36 Parker, Reuben 13 son Parker, Lidda C. 9 daughter Parker, Laura L. 5 daughter Parker, Alfred 1 son Rice, William H. 18 stepson Rice, Jesse 17 stepson and in 1880 in the Shoal Creek Twp Ingram, John 75 Ingram, Mary 76 Ingram, Harriet 45 daughter Ingram, Sarah 32 daughter Parker, John 27 grandson Parker, Mary 17 grandaughter In the 1900 census of Cherokee Co NC Parker, John 49 born 10-1850 Ingram, Harriet 65 aunt born 11-1834 Parker, Ellen 38 born April 1862 Now my question is. Did Alexander Parker remarry by 1870 or is this another Alexander Parker? And if Alexander did remarry, why did the children live with the grandparents from then on?
